Gerçek Zamanlı Oyun Topluluklarını Kurmak: DNS ve Hosting'in Derinliklerine İnmek
Oyun Platformları Neden Teknik Altyapıya Bağımlı?
Canlı bir satranç turnuvasında oynuyorsunuz ya da multiplayerli bir oyunda arkadaşlarınızla yarışıyorsunuz. O anda domain kaydından, DNS ayarlarından, sunucu konumundan hiç bahsetmiyorsunuz. Ama her sorunsuz hamle, her anında gelen bildirim, hiçbir gecikme yaşanmayan o deneyimin arkasında devasa bir teknik ekip ve altyapı vardır.
Milyonlarca oyuncunun aynı anda oyunayabilmesi için neler gerekli? Ve neden domain stratejisi sizin düşündüğünüzden çok daha önemli? Gelin bunu birlikte keşfedelim.
DNS: Oyun Dünyasının En Kritik Silahı
Hiçbir oyuncu düşünmez bunu, ama oyun sitesine girdiğiniz an tarayıcınız bir DNS sorgusu yapıyor. O minuscule gecikme, binlerce istek üzerinde birikerek ciddi sorunlara dönüşebiliyor.
Başarılı oyun platformları şu DNS stratejilerini kullanmak zorundadırlar:
- Coğrafi DNS yönlendirmesi ile oyuncuları en yakın sunucuya bağlamak
- Çok düşük TTL değerleri sayesinde aksaklık anında gidermeyi sağlamak
- DNSSEC koruması ile oyunu kesintiye uğratacak saldırıları engellemek
Kuzey Amerika, Avrupa ve Asya'da aynı anda oyuncularına hizmet veren bir platform herkeyi tek sunucuya bağlayamaz. Tokyo'daki oyuncu Tokyo sunucularına, Berlin'deki oyuncu Avrupa sunucularına bağlanmalı.
Rekabetçi oyunlarda her milisaniye sayılır. Doğru DNS yapılandırması, bu farkı yaratır.
Domain Kaydı Sadece İlk Adım Değil
Çoğu geliştirici domain kaydını hazırlık işlemesi gibi görür: "Kaydettirdim, nameserverları ayarladım, bitti." Ama oyun platformları bu konuda farklı düşünmelidir.
İyi bir domain sağlayıcısından beklenmesi gereken özellikler:
- API desteği olan profesyonel DNS yönetimi ve dinamik güncelleme imkanı
- DNS seviyesinde DDoS koruması (oyun sektörü saldırıların favori hedefidir)
- Hızlı SSL kurulumu ve otomatik yenileme
- Yedekli nameserver altyapısı böylece DNS sorguları asla başarısız olmaz
NameOcean gibi platformlar işte bu noktada işime yarar. Kurumsal seviye hizmetleri sunup ama bedeli uygun tutar, dahası tümleşik hosting çözümü sayesinde multiple vendor karmaşasından kurtarır.
Hosting Mimarisi: Sıradan Blog Sunucusu Yeterli Değil
Gerçek zamanlı oyun platformları blog hosting gibi değildir. Paylaşımlı hosting yetersizdir, ve tek bir sunucu büyüdüğünüz zaman işe yaramaz.
Başarılı oyun platformları şunu kurgulamıştır:
- Çok bölgeli bulut dağıtımı ve otomatik yedek devralmesi
- WebSocket sunucuları (HTTP polling'in sahtesi değil, asıl şey budur)
- Mesaj kuyrukları (Redis, RabbitMQ) milyonlarca eşzamanlı bağlantıyı yönetmek için
- Çok bölgelerde veritabanı kopyalaması oyun verilerine gecikme minimize etmek için
- CDN caching (oyun tahtası görselleri, taş vb. UI öğeleri için)
Satranç topluluğu 500ms gecikmeyi kaldıramaz. 50ms düşürmek mu gerekli? O zaman doğru altyapı seçimi hayati önem kazanır.
SSL/TLS: Sadece Kilitli Kilit İşareti Değil
Oyuncular tahtaların konumunu paylaşırken, oyunları analiz ederken, turnuvalarda katılırken tüm trafik şifrelenmesi lazım. Ama dikkat: standart SSL sertifikaları gecikmeye sebep olabilir.
Modern oyun platformları şu özellikleri talep eder:
- Wildcard SSL sertifikaları birden çok alt domain kapsayacak şekilde
- HTTP/2 ve HTTP/3 desteği bağlantı hızlandırmak için
- Sertifika pinning mobil uygulamalarda ortadaki adam saldırılarını önlemek için
- Zero-trust mimarisi kendi altyapınız içinde bile güvenlik sağlamak için
En güzel tarafı? NameOcean'ın Vibe Hosting, LetsEncrypt ile otomatik SSL sağlaması yapıyor. Sertifikaları DevOps başağrısı olmadan kendileri yenileniyor.
Yapay Zeka Yardımı ile Altyapı Kurması
İşte burası heyecan verici. Eskiden oyun altyapısı kurmak devasa bir DevOps takımı gerektiriyordu. Artık yapay zeka yardımcıları:
- Sizin ihtiyaçlarınıza uygun altyapı kodları otomatik olarak yazıyor
- DNS ayarlarını oyuncu coğrafyasına göre optimize ediyor
- Traffic piklerini tahmin ederek kaynakları önceden ölçeklendiriyor
- Gecikme sorunlarını gerçek zamanlı AI analizi ile saptıyor
NameOcean'ın vibe coding yaklaşımı ile siz oyun mantığına odaklanırken, AI altyapı karmaşasını hallediyor. Deploy süreci artık kod yazı değil, birer konuşma haline geliyor.
Gerçek Hayat Örneği
Küresel bir satranç platformu başlatmak için:
- Kaliteli DNS altyapısına sahip bir domain kaydı
- Akıllı yönlendirme ile çok bölge dağıtımı
- WebSocket sunucuları canlı hamleleri için
- Oyuncu verilerini modern SSL/TLS ile koruma
- Statik dosyalar için CDN
- Her şeyi kesinti ve gecikme açısından takip etmek
Bunlardan herhangi birini atlarsanız, oyuncular rakip plataforma kaçıyor.
Başlamak İçin Kontrol Listesi
Yeni nesil rekabetçi oyun platformu inşa ediyorsanız, bu başlıkları önceliklendir:
- Premium DNS araçlarına sahip bir kayıt sağlayıcısı seç – Domain'in kaderi temel nameserverlarla kararlaştırılamaz
- Çok bölgeli hosting'i en başından planla – Sonra ölçeklendirmek pahalı ve karmaşık olur
- SSL/TLS'yi düzgün çalıştır – Modern protokoller ile ek yük minimal
- WebSocket kullan, polling yapma – Sunucu maliyetleri ve gecikme şükredersin
- CDN deploy et – Statik dosyalar çoğu zaman en büyük bant tüketicisi
- Veritabanını önceden dizayn et – Çok bölgede replikasyon yapılmadan olmaz
Teknoloji Yarışında Kim Kazanıyor?
Bugün kazanan oyun platformları, daha "cool" oyunlar olduğu için değil kazanıyorlar. Kazanıyorlar çünkü çoğu insanın görmediği teknik detayları çok ciddiye alıyorlar.
Ortadan kaldırdığınız her milisaniye gecikme, daha iyi oyuncu deneyimi demektir. Eklediğiniz her çift dokuz uptime (99.99% vs 99.9999%), binlerce kesintisiz turnuva saati anlamına geliyor. Aldığınız her güvenlik önlemi, topluluğunuza karşı inşa ettiğiniz güven demektir.
Altyapı göz kamaştırıcı değil. Ama bunu doğru yapanlar ile yapmayan arasındaki farkı yaratır.
NameOcean ile premium domain yönetimi, akıllı DNS yönlendirmesi ve vibe hosting teknolojisine sahip, milyonlarca oyuncuya ölçeklenebilir bir platform kurmaya başlamak çok kolaydır.